GOODHUE SETS NEW MARK AS RUNNERS OUTDO HOLY CROSS

University Captain Leads Field in Major Race--Currier, Putnam Turn in Good Performances

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

A record which had stood since 1928 was shattered yesterday when N. M. Goodhue '35 led a field of 32 entrants to finish first against the Holy Cross Freshmen as the Crimson first year men triumphed 23 to 46. At the same time the University team, led by Captain N. P. Hallowell, Jr. '32, made a clean sweep of the first six places to win from the Crusaders, 15 to 55.

Goodhue led throughout the Freshman race over the Soldiers Field time trial course, which measures slightly under one and one half miles, to finish in 7 minutes, 28 1-5 seconds. The old mark, set in 1928 by B. E. Estes '32, was 7 minutes, 40 seconds. Kenney of Holy Cross, A. S. Pier '35, and Nowling of Holy Cross followed Goodhue at intervals of one fifth second.

Hallowell Leads Field

Captain Hallowell, although he has been prevented by examinations from running during the last four or five days, had little trouble in leading the pack over a three and three-quarter miles flat course to turn in a time of 17 minutes and 33 1-5 seconds. C. B. Currier '32, who has not practiced with the team regularly during the 1930 season staged a surprise by placing fourth, and J. W. Putnam '33 showed up well as the eighth Crimson runner to finish.

Harvard 15, Holy Cross 55. Winner, N. P. Hallowell, Jr. '32; J. M. Fox '32, B. E. Estes '32, C. B. Currier '32, F. D. Murphy '33, Arthur Foote '33, Blake (H.C.), McManus (H.C.), G. N. Barrie '32, Cuneo (H.C.), J. W. Putnam '33, J. M. Estabrook '34, James Parton '34, Parent (H.C.), F. L. Steele '33, Yakavonis (H.C.), Time, 17 min., 33 1-5 sec.

Harvard Freshmen 23, Holy Cross Freshmen 46. Winner, N. M. Goodhue '35; Kenney (H.C.), A. S. Pier '35, Nowling (H.C.), C. F. Woodward '35, R. B. Cutler '35, Burke (H.C.), W. L. Post '35, F. A. Webster '35, E. W. Clark '35, Henry Derrickson '35, G. T. Wagner '35, S. Y. Andelman '35, Charles Seeman '35, J. P. Scheu '35, Hayward (H.C.). Time, 7 min., 28 1-5 sec.
